China’s 360 Security Unveils AI Cyber Tools to Rival Anthropic’s Mythos

The global arena for artificial intelligence has shifted rapidly from writing creative essays to managing national security infrastructure. During a major cybersecurity conference in Beijing, the prominent Chinese technology firm 360 Security Technology introduced a new suite of artificial intelligence tools designed to counter advanced Western models. Named “Yitian Tulong” after a classic martial arts novel, the package represents a direct attempt to match the sophisticated cyber capabilities developed by American firms. The launch highlights a growing consensus among international technology experts that defensive and offensive computer security will soon run almost entirely on automated, intelligent systems.

The Chinese package consists of two distinct software engines designed to handle opposite sides of the cybersecurity spectrum. The first tool, called “Tulongfeng,” focuses on the automated discovery of software vulnerabilities. During its initial trials, this tool successfully scanned complex computer programs and identified more than 3,400 software vulnerabilities. National agencies have already officially verified 105 of those security flaws. The second tool, “Yitianzhen,” automates system defense and immediate incident response. Together, these systems manage the constant cycle of identifying software weaknesses and patching them before malicious actors can exploit the openings.

This dual-tool release directly targets the capabilities of Anthropic’s Mythos, a highly advanced artificial intelligence model that made its public preview debut earlier this year. Developed by the San Francisco-based AI developer Anthropic, which recently reached a private market valuation of $965 billion, Mythos surprised the industry with its ability to find and exploit complex software bugs autonomously. The U.S. startup chose to restrict access to Mythos, granting entry to only a few dozen select organizations to prevent the technology from falling into the hands of hostile states or criminal groups. The exceptional power of Mythos even prompted the United States government to step in, placing strict export limits on the technology due to fears over global digital safety.

Chinese technology leaders view the lack of domestic access to these advanced Western systems as a significant strategic vulnerability. The founder of 360 Security, Zhou Hongyi, argued during his presentation that China could not afford to exist in a state of “one-way transparency” where foreign governments possess automated hacking and defense systems while domestic enterprises remain empty-handed. He described these advanced AI tools as critical national strategic assets. According to Zhou, such powerful technology changes the very nature of cyber warfare, and building a local alternative is necessary to safeguard the country’s public utilities, banks, and critical infrastructure networks.

Developing a comparable alternative has forced Chinese engineers to innovate around significant hardware bottlenecks. Severe trade restrictions and export controls prevent Chinese firms from acquiring the latest high-performance semiconductor chips necessary to train massive, monolithic models. To overcome this limitation, 360 Security utilized a specialized multi-agent architectural framework. Instead of relying on one massive, resource-heavy model, this approach links together several smaller, highly specialized AI “agents” that collaborate to solve complex programming tasks. Tech analysts report that this collaborative agent design allows the company to achieve capabilities comparable to Western systems like Mythos without requiring the same level of raw computing power.

The financial stakes surrounding this technological race remain incredibly high. Listed on the Shanghai Stock Exchange under the ticker 601360, 360 Security Technology holds a market capitalization of approximately 67.06 billion CNY, which converts to roughly $9.2 billion USD. The company operates a massive security network across Asia and reported a trailing 12-month revenue of $1.19 billion USD. As investors recognize the potential of AI-driven compliance and defensive tools, the company’s stock has experienced notable volatility, trading within a wide 52-week range of 8.88 CNY to 14.68 CNY. Financial analysts point out that the rising demand for domestic AI solutions could significantly alter the revenue models of enterprise security firms over the next fiscal year.

The development of these tools is part of a broader Chinese movement to build independent artificial intelligence systems. For instance, the domestic AI research firm Zhipu recently rolled out its GLM 5.2 language model, which independent evaluators say approaches the performance of other leading Western models. Observers at European cybersecurity research centers, including the Center for Security Studies at ETH Zurich, have noted that while some claims made by tech firms are naturally elevated for marketing purposes, the underlying progress is undeniable. Western industry experts previously estimated that Chinese developers would lag six to twelve months behind their American counterparts in replicating these capabilities, a window that appears to be closing much faster than expected.

Ultimately, the transition to autonomous cybersecurity tools introduces new challenges for the global tech industry. When automated systems can scan, discover, and weaponize software vulnerabilities at machine speed, traditional human-led defense methods become obsolete. If an automated tool can find thousands of zero-day exploits in widely used operating systems within hours, security teams will have to rely on opposing AI engines to write and deploy patches before attacks happen. This reality turns the geopolitical technology race into a contest of speed, where the stability of global digital commerce depends on which automated system acts first.
